What Size Dumpster Do I Want for a Roofing Project?

Choosing a dumpster size necessitates some educated guesswork. It is often difficult for people to gauge the sizes that they need for roofing projects because, realistically, they have no idea how much stuff their roofs feature.

There are, however, some basic guidelines you'll be able to follow to make a superb alternative. If you're removing a commercial roof, then you will most likely need a dumpster that gives you at least 40 square yards.

If you're working on residential roofing project, then you can generally rely on a smaller size. You can generally expect a 1,500 square foot roof to fill a 10-yard dumpster. Single shingle roof debris from a 2,500-3,000 square foot roof will likely desire a 20-yard dumpster.

Many folks order one size larger than they think their jobs will take since they would like to stay away from the additional expense and hassle of replacing complete dumpsters which were not large enough.

Getting the top estimate on your dumpster

One of the largest concerns you likely have when renting a dumpster in Little Rock is how much it will cost. One of the best ways to negate this fear would be to get precise advice. When you call to get a price quote, have recommended of just how much waste you'll need to get rid of so you can get the top recommendation on dumpster size. In case you're not sure on the amount of waste, renting a size bigger will save you the additional expense of renting a second dumpster if the first proves overly small.

Provide any information you believe is applicable to be sure you don't end up paying for services that you don't really want. More than a few companies charge by the container size, while others charge by weight. Be sure you know which is which so you've a clear estimate. Likewise, make sure to request whether the estimate you get comprises landfill charges; this will keep you from being surprised by an additional fee after.


10 yard dumpster measurements in Little Rock

A 10 yard dumpster is built to hold 10 cubic yards of waste and debris. A 10 yard dumpster will measure approximately 12 feet long by 8 feet wide by four feet high, although precise container sizes will vary with different businesses.

It may be difficult to select exactly the container size you will need for your home project, but a 10 yard dumpster functions well for smaller cleaning occupations. To provide you with an idea, a 10 yard dumpster would hold:

  • Debris cleanout from a basement or garage A 250 square foot deck which has been removed
  • A single layer of 1,500 square feet of roof shingles
  • The debris from a small kitchen or bathroom remodeling job

If your job is big enough that you don't have room in your truck to haul everything to the dump, but small enough that you don't desire an enormous container, a 10 yard dumpster should function perfectly.

What is the smallest size dumpster available?

The smallest size roll-off dumpster generally available is 10 yards. This container will carry about 10 cubic yards of waste and debris, which is roughly equal to 3 to 5 pickup truck loads of waste. This dumpster is an excellent choice for small-scale projects, including little dwelling cleanouts.

Other examples of projects that a 10 yard container would function nicely for include: A garage, shed or attic cleanout A 250 square foot deck removal 2,000 to 2,500 square feet of single layer roofing shingles A little kitchen or bathroom remodeling project Concrete or dirt removal Getting rid of garbage Be aware that weight limitations for the containers are demanded, thus exceeding the weight limit will incur additional charges. The standard weight limit for a 10 yard bin is 1 to 3 tons (2,000 to 6,000 pounds).

A 10 yard bin will help you take good care of small projects around the house. When you have a larger project coming up, take a look at some larger containers also.


Roll Off Dumpster vs. Dumpster Tote

Dumpster totes may offer an alternative to roll of dumpsters. Whether this alternative works well for you, though, will depend on your own job. Consider these pros and cons before you pick a disposal option that works for you.

Roll Off Dumpsters

It's difficult to conquer a roll off dumpster when you've got a sizable job that will create plenty of debris. Most rental companies include dropping off and picking up the dumpster in the costs, so you could avoid additional fees. Roll off dumpsters usually have time constraints because businesses need to get them back for other customers. This is a possible disadvantage if you aren't great at meeting deadlines.

Dumpster Totes

Dumpster totes in many cases are suitable for small jobs with free deadlines. If you don't need lots of room for debris, then the bags could work well for you. Many companies are also pleased to let you keep the totes for as long as you need. That makes them useful for longer projects.

Does my waste get recycled?

When you rent a short-term dumpster, your goal is to fill it up and have the waste hauled away. But if you prefer your waste recycled, you might have to go about it in a somewhat different style. Waste in the majority of temporary dumpsters is not recycled as the containers are so large and hold so much material.

If you are interested in recycling any waste from your job, check into getting smaller containers. Many dumpster rental companies in Little Rock have a broad range of containers available, including those for recycling. These are generally smaller than temporary dumpsters; they are the size of regular trash bins and smaller.

If you need to recycle, find out if the business you're working with uses single stream recycling (you usually do not have to sort the stuff) or if you'll need to form the recyclable material into different containers (aluminum cans, cardboard, plastics, etc.) This can really make a difference in the variety of containers you need to rent.

What is the biggest size dumpster accessible?

The biggest roll off dumpster that companies usually rent is a 40 yard container. This huge dumpster will hold up to 40 cubic yards of debris, which is comparable to between 12 and 20 pickup truck loads of debris.

The weight limit on 40 yard containers usually ranges from 4 to 8 tons (8,000 to 16,000 pounds). Be quite mindful of the limit and do your best not to transcend it. If you do go over the limit, you can incur overage fees, which add up quickly.

Examples of jobs that a 40 yard container will likely be the ideal size for contain: A foreclosure or estate cleanout A 750 square foot deck removal 4,000 square feet of roofing shingles in multiple layers Whole-dwelling interior renovation Getting rid of junk when you're moving in or out House demolition New house building Commercial and residential cleanouts


What Types of Debris Can I Place Into a Dumpster?

It's possible for you to place most types of debris into a dumpster rental in Little Rock. There are, however, some exclusions. For instance, you cannot put compounds into a dumpster. That includes motor oil, paints, solvents, automotive fluids, pesticides, and cleaning agents. Electronic Equipment and batteries are also prohibited. If something poses an environmental hazard, you probably cannot put it in a dumpster. Get in touch with your rental company if you are uncertain.

That leaves most varieties of debris you could put in the dumpster, comprise drywall, concrete, lumber, and yard waste. Pretty much any kind of debris left from a building job can go in the dumpster.

Specific kinds of okay debris, however, may require additional fees. If your plan is to throw away used tires, mattresses, or appliances, you need to ask the rental company whether you are required to pay another fee. Adding these to your dumpster may cost anywhere from $25 to $100, depending on the item.
